Transaction efe71645f96015d867b1616eaaf544a4f7207e766f940a62f46cf33d64c0bb17

1 Input
2 Outputs
  • efe71645f96015d867b1616eaaf544a4f7207e766f940a62f46cf33d64c0bb17:0
  • value  552751
    address  34yyird2ephA5ZRKW7iWE1N9EzQTeaVFAL
  • efe71645f96015d867b1616eaaf544a4f7207e766f940a62f46cf33d64c0bb17:1
  • value  207060143
    address  19Sic9zym5bwpzyJMhYFUnZHeJJrKfEnBq